Welcome to the AI Agents Handbook! This repository is a collaborative and open-source project dedicated to providing a comprehensive, practical guide to building, deploying, and refining AI agents for real-world applications. Our goal is to create a central resource for anyone interested in AI agents—from beginners to advanced practitioners—to deepen their understanding, improve their skills, and contribute to the growing field of AI.
In the rapidly evolving world of artificial intelligence, AI agents are becoming pivotal tools across industries. They can independently gather information, make decisions, and complete complex tasks, offering endless possibilities. But developing effective, efficient, and reliable agents isn’t always easy. The AI Agents Handbook was created to:
- Demystify AI agents: Explain concepts in a way that's accessible to beginners but valuable to seasoned developers.
- Bridge theory and practice: Offer practical examples, code snippets, and step-by-step instructions to help users bring ideas to life.
- Foster community growth: Encourage collaboration and knowledge-sharing among AI enthusiasts and professionals alike.
We aim to make this handbook a go-to resource for building and deploying intelligent, autonomous systems that solve real-world problems.
This handbook covers a wide range of topics related to AI agents, including but not limited to:
- Introduction to AI Agents: What are they, and why are they transformative?
- Core Concepts: Understanding the basics of machine learning, natural language processing, computer vision, and reinforcement learning.
- Architecture and Design: Best practices for designing modular, maintainable, and scalable agents.
- Deployment Strategies: Tips for deploying agents in various environments—whether on the cloud, on-premise, or embedded systems.
- Real-World Applications: Case studies and tutorials that show how AI agents can be applied to fields like finance, healthcare, marketing, and more.
- Ethics and Safety: Guidelines on developing responsible, ethical AI agents and handling sensitive data.
This content is structured to provide a balanced blend of theory, practical insights, and code snippets so readers can immediately start applying their knowledge.
To get started with the code snippets in this repository:
- Clone the repository to your local machine:
git clone https://github.com/DTiapan/ai-agents-handbook.git
The AI Agents Handbook is a community-driven project! Whether you're a researcher, developer, or AI enthusiast, we welcome your contributions. There are many ways to get involved:
- Add a New Section: If there’s a topic or technique missing that you’re passionate about, feel free to add it!
- Improve Existing Content: Found a typo, outdated information, or an area that needs clarification? We'd love your help improving it.
- Share Your Project: If you've developed a unique AI agent or used them in a novel way, contribute a case study!
- Provide Feedback: Open issues, discuss ideas, and suggest improvements—your input will help shape the direction of this project.
Creating intelligent systems that make a positive impact requires collaboration, innovation, and open knowledge. With the AI Agents Handbook, we hope to empower individuals and teams to learn, experiment, and push the boundaries of what AI agents can achieve. Together, we can build a future where AI agents are responsible, impactful, and accessible to all.
Join us in this journey and help make AI agents accessible and useful to everyone.
We are excited to connect with others in the AI community! If you’re interested in collaborating, contributing, or exploring sponsorship opportunities, please feel free to reach out. We’re always open to meaningful partnerships and innovative ideas.
- Email: bakran.ajas@gmail.com
- LinkedIn: ajasbakran
Feel free to contact us for collaboration ideas, or if you have any questions about AI Agents Handbook. Let’s work together to drive AI forward!
we look forward to building a collaborative and inspiring resource for the AI community.